[23315] trunk/dports/gnome/gnucash-devel/Portfile

source_changes at macosforge.org source_changes at macosforge.org
Wed Mar 28 11:26:40 PDT 2007


Revision: 23315
          http://trac.macosforge.org/projects/macports/changeset/23315
Author:   mas at macports.org
Date:     2007-03-28 11:26:40 -0700 (Wed, 28 Mar 2007)

Log Message:
-----------
upgrade to svn.tag 15760; build with OFX by default; depend on guile16 and slib-guile16 by default (fixing breakage after guile 1.8.1 update)

Modified Paths:
--------------
    trunk/dports/gnome/gnucash-devel/Portfile

Modified: trunk/dports/gnome/gnucash-devel/Portfile
===================================================================
--- trunk/dports/gnome/gnucash-devel/Portfile	2007-03-28 18:06:53 UTC (rev 23314)
+++ trunk/dports/gnome/gnucash-devel/Portfile	2007-03-28 18:26:40 UTC (rev 23315)
@@ -2,7 +2,7 @@
 
 PortSystem        1.0
 name              gnucash-devel
-svn.tag		  15425
+svn.tag		  15760
 	# see http://svn.gnucash.org/trac/timeline
 version		  2.0.99.svn-${svn.tag}
 revision	  0
@@ -20,9 +20,11 @@
 		  to a working copy in case anything goes wrong.
 homepage          http://www.gnucash.org/
 depends_lib	  lib:XML/Parser.pm:p5-xml-parser \
-		  port:glib1 \
 		  port:glib2 \
 		  port:gconf \
+		  port:guile \
+		  port:slib \
+		  port:slib-guile \
 		  lib:libpopt:popt \
 		  lib:libgnomeui:libgnomeui \
 		  lib:libgnomeprintui:libgnomeprintui \
@@ -30,6 +32,7 @@
 		  lib:libgsf:libgsf \
 		  lib:libgoffice:goffice \
 		  lib:aqbanking:aqbanking \
+		  lib:libofx:libofx \
 		  lib:Finance/Quote.pm:p5-finance-quote \
 		  port:gnucash-docs
 depends_build	  bin:glibtoolize:libtool port:automake bin:swig:swig
@@ -46,16 +49,20 @@
 		  CFLAGS="-L${prefix}/lib -I${prefix}/include" \
 		  LDFLAGS=-L${prefix}/lib
 configure.args	  --disable-glibtest --disable-debug --disable-profile \
-		  --disable-dependency-tracking --enable-hbci
+		  --disable-dependency-tracking --enable-hbci --enable-ofx
 
+default_variants +guile16
+
 variant without_hbci {
 	depends_lib-delete	lib:aqbanking:aqbanking
 	configure.args-delete	--enable-hbci
+	configure.args-append	--disable-hbci
 }
 
-variant enable_ofx {
-	depends_lib-append	lib:libofx:libofx
-	configure.args-append	--enable-ofx
+variant without_ofx {
+	depends_lib-delete	lib:libofx:libofx
+	configure.args-delete	--enable-ofx
+	configure.args-append	--disable-ofx
 }
 
 variant without_quotes {
@@ -65,3 +72,10 @@
 variant without_docs {
 	depends_lib-delete	port:gnucash-docs
 }
+
+variant guile16 {
+	depends_lib-delete	port:guile
+	depends_lib-delete	port:slib-guile
+	depends_lib-append	port:guile16 \
+				port:slib-guile16
+}

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.macosforge.org/pipermail/macports-changes/attachments/20070328/ffb41e52/attachment.html


More information about the macports-changes mailing list